Bonuses and Promotions: A Double-Edged Sword
Bonuses can be the carrot or the stick in the online casino world. Legiano’s promotions are modest, steering clear of the hyperbolic “best bonuses” claims that often come with strings attached. Instead, the offers are transparent, with clear terms and conditions that don’t require a magnifying glass to decipher.
Still, the cautious player might raise an eyebrow at the wagering requirements, which, while reasonable, are not exactly a walk in the park. It’s a reminder that in gambling, the house always holds some advantage, no matter how friendly the welcome package seems.
Table: Overview of Legiano’s Bonus Structure
| Bonus Type | Offer Details | Wagering Requirements | Validity Period |
|---|---|---|---|
| Welcome Bonus | 100% match up to $200 + 50 free spins | 35x bonus amount | 30 days |
| Reload Bonus | 50% match up to $100 | 30x bonus amount | 14 days |
| Free Spins | 20 free spins on selected slots | 40x winnings from free spins | 7 days |
